How they compare

Mauritania currently reports 39,250 1000 ha against 38,000 1000 ha in Namibia, a difference of 1,250 1000 ha.

Across all 64 years both countries report, Mauritania has been ahead every year.

Mauritania ranks 19th and Namibia ranks 20th of 220 countries.

Mauritania has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

The FAOSTAT Land Use domain contains data on twenty-one land use categories and twenty-three categories of irrigation and agricultural practices. Data are available yearly and by country, regional and global levels. The domain includes Land Use Indicators providing information on the percentage share of agricultural and forest land, and their sub-components, including irrigated areas and areas under organic agriculture, within a country land use matrix. Data are available at country, regional and global level, for the following elements: (in percentage) i) Share in Land area; ii) Share in Agricultural land, iii) Share in Cropland; and iv) Share in Forest land; (in ha/pc) v) Area per capita.
